It always feels weird to me when people portrait PK as having no remorse 'cause like. In my head he's DEFINED by his remorse for what he's done
@hishap Exactly. Imo canon clearly shows this remorse. The statue of the Hollow Knight, how he removed himself from public, the figures from the past that turned away from him, the fountain of him is set into the abyss and the remains of the White Palace too. All canon information are pointing to him having been eaten by the guilt and the regret and it only gets truer when you meet him or his final echo in the White Palace.
